Kruger National Park
Visit to South Africa is not complete without a visit to see the amazing Kruger National Park. This is an incredibly beautiful park which is located in the far north-eastern corner of South Africa sharing its border with Mozambique. Kruger Park safari has something for everyone when enjoying an African safari. One can experience a hiking safari or a horseback ride, and also there are beautiful swimming pools to cool down when you get back to your colonial style lodge accommodation. For many people travel to Africa means just visiting the Kruger National park which is South Africa's largest game reserve boasting a diverse wildlife. This is very much true but South African safari also offers many excellent regions that you can choose according to your taste and budget. Keep Kruger at the top of your list there are also other regions that are exciting to see such as coastal towns of Hermanus, Cape Town, Knysna , Durban, cape town trips and many more .
